Description
Orcus mouth sculpture at famous Parco dei Mostri (Park of the Monsters), also named Sacro Bosco (Sacred Grove) or Gardens of Bomarzo in Bomarzo, province of Viterbo, northern Lazio, Italy
Orcus mouth sculpture at famous Parco dei Mostri (Park of the Monsters), also named Sacro Bosco (Sacred Grove) or Gardens of Bomarzo in Bomarzo, province of Viterbo, northern Lazio, Italy
Learn more about royalty-free images or view FAQs related to stock photos.